Anna Hoke is a fifth generation Alaskan who was born and raised in Juneau. Anna graduated from Juneau-Douglas High School in 2003 and then attended the University of Alaska Fairbanks for several years before returning to Juneau in 2005 to study English at the University of Alaska Southeast. She has worked as a graphic designer and developer since 2007, both freelance and in the private sector as a production manager, as well as a publication tech for the State of Alaska. Her background also includes extensive experience designing marketing and promotional materials, photography, website design, editing and writing. She is the owner of Southeast Living Magazine which was founded in 2010. Anna lives in the valley with her husband Hayden, daughter Ariana and cat Tron.
